Srinagar, Dec 14 (KNO): Police in Awantipora on Monday distributed COVID-19 safety kits among needy people under Civic Action Programme in third phase.
As per a statement issued to the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O), in 1st phase 232 COVID-19 containment kits were distributed at Police Station Khrew and Pampore and in 2nd phase 117 Covid-19 Kits were distributed at Police station Awantipora. “Today in 3rd phase, 117 Covid-19 safety kits were distributed at Police Station Tral,” police said.
SHO PS Tral Ghulam Mohammad Rather held the distribution function at Police Station Tral. Each Covid-19 safety kit contains 01 steam vaporizer, 02 face shield, 100 surgical masks, 01 Oximeter, 01 digital Thermometer, 01 sanitizer bottle (500 ml), 01 Box hand gloves, 01 hand wash and other essential items were distributed among the poor and needy families, the statement said.
On the occasion, SHO PS Tral said that there is a need for sensitizing the society to prevent the needy and poor families from COVID-19—(KNO)
